sql 语句中,能不能实现类似搜索引擎中的多个关键词搜索?(50分)

  • 主题发起人 主题发起人 littlefat
  • 开始时间 开始时间
L

littlefat

Unregistered / Unconfirmed
GUEST, unregistred user!
比如我使用“a b”(a空格b)作为关键词搜索同时包含a和b两个词(位置无关)的记录?如何实现?
 
用ExtractStrings提出字符串列表,然后根据得到列表生成SQL语句
 
ExtractStrings扩展出来之后,再用个循环组合成
   关键字='a' or 关键字='b'的形式,再进行查询。
 
可以举例说明么?这样对db引擎来说,是一次查询还是两次查询?
 
楼上说得可以.
 
后退
顶部